During the long summer days, highs generally are in the 80's at Browns Lakes. Throughout the dark hours of summer temperatures descend
| | | |
| | down into the 60's. Through the winter highs are in the 50's with temperatures at Browns Lakes dipping down into the 30's through winter nights.
